Day 3 had some disappointing news, apparently the bumper has some air bubbles on the surface, when chad went to blow out the pin holes chunks of surface were ripped off b/c of the air pockets below them... its something he said he's seen on many body kits but i guess he was hoping that there wouldnt be much of a problem with it on this bumper... project will take until friday now, color goes on tomorrow morning... or atleast starts, so tomorrow i should be posting paint pictures, sorry to let you guys down on the color but i want it done right over fast. here's where we're at though, over the night most of the bumper got finished, the scoop is off, the holes from the old scoop install are all sanded down and prepped for welding. the massive door ding i had over my passenger rear wheel well has been pulled for the most part, needs to be smoothed, and it's been sanded.
